Remember, a personal exemption of $3650 is not deducted on tax but on your taxable income. Say for example your filing status is 'married filing jointly' with original taxable income of $100,000. This allows under the marginal tax rate of 25%. So the money you can save on personal exemption is $912.50 (calculation is simple: $3650 multiplied by 25%). For you and the spouse, that are multiplied by two which save $1825.
